The input output mechanism however remained largely unchanged. second generation computers were programmed using a symbolic or assembly language. the computers also implemented the stored program concept which allowed both program and data to reside in memory. In full electronic numerical integrator and computer , the first programmable general purpose electronic digital computer, built during world war ii by the united states.
